#648527 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#648527 is composed of 39.2% red, 52.2%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.7%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 81.1 degrees, a saturation of 54.7% and a lightness of 33.7%. #648527 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8ff4e with #000b00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#648527

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090c03 is the darkest color, while #fdf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#648527

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565755 is the less saturated color, while #6ea606 is the most saturated one.
